Rest api json date format. HAL - Like OData but aiming to be HATEOAS like.

  • Rest api json date format Example: {"name":"Andrew"} date: A string value conforming to the ISO 8601 format. When your REST Endpoint exposes some Data and Time fields in JSON Format, you can mainly use two formats: A java. sql. JSON API - JSON API covers creating and updating resources as well, not just responses. Why Use JSON in REST APIs? Lightweight & Fast: JSON data is compact, making it faster to parse compared to XML. Human-Readable: The simple structure of JSON allows developers to read and debug the data easily. Proper REST URL format. Using @JsonFormat on a Date Field. What is an API? The term API stands for “Application Programming Interface”. Proper REST URI date range. A JSON API allows applications to exchange data in JSON (JavaScript Object Notation) format, which is lightweight and widely supported. What is a preferred string format for dates in a REST API. JSON Schema (used by swagger but you could use it stand Dec 6, 2023 · As a conclusion In the realm of RESTful APIs, data format selection is pivotal, with JSON and XML taking the lead. This leads to a number of trade-offs. JSON supports nested data structures, making it suitable for representing complex objects. Let’s dissect this anatomy to understand its components better. Oct 1, 2023 · The most widely accepted date format for REST APIs is the ISO 8601 standard. JSend - Simple and probably what you are already doing. System dates imply a scientific, linear view of time. JSON (JavaScript Object Notation) JSON is a common data format used in REST APIs. The anatomy of an API response in JSON format is akin to the structure of a well-organized document. Now, let’s see how JSON is used to format and exchange data in RESTful APIs. Oct 27, 2023 · This article will explain the data formats used in REST APIs, including JSON and XML, and how they are employed. Aug 23, 2022 · The formats they named full-date, full-time, and date-time are widely accepted and adopted by JSON Schema formats as date, time, and date-time, respectively. js, have built-in support for parsing JSON data. Setting the Format. I have used Rest Api as source and AZ SQL DB as target. 2. Jul 16, 2020 · I am trying to copy data from rest api source using the azure copy activity. Why Use JSON in RESTful APIs? Lightweight and Efficient: JSON is a minimalistic format, making it faster to parse and transfer compared to XML or other formats. Likewise in XML Schema, these are known as xs:date, xs:time, and xs:dateTime. 6. JSON is widely used due to its lightweight nature, easy readability, and compatibility with various programming languages. XML, in contrast, excels in complex data hierarchies and precise validation. Similar to a C or Java string. It consists of key-value pairs that represent data in a structured, hierarchical manner. This data interchange can happen between two computer applications at different geographical locations or running within the same machine. The formats they named full-date, full-time, and date-time are widely accepted and adopted by JSON Schema formats as date, time, and date-time, respectively. May 9, 2023 · JSON does not have a native date type, so APIs typically represent dates as either numbers or strings. Key aspects: Lightweight, human Feb 23, 2025 · By default, Spring Boot returns responses in JSON, making it the standard format for most RESTful services. 1. 0. May 11, 2024 · In this tutorial, we’ll show how to format JSON date fields in a Spring Boot application. Likewise in XML Schema, these are known as xs:date , xs:time , and xs:dateTime . Defaults for Date / Time in REST Application. JSON is a text-based data exchange format with similarities to JavaScript and C-family languages. May 27, 2022 · This article will teach you the simplest way to map Date and Time fields in an Entity when the request/response is from a REST Endpoint. We’ll explore various ways of formatting dates using Jackson, which Spring Boot uses as its default JSON processor. Nov 3, 2023 · JSON (JavaScript Object Notation) is the most widely used data format for data interchange on the web. For example: Sep 16, 2024 · In this article, I will cover what an API is, how RESTful APIs work, and the data formats XML and JSON. 1. So Nov 12, 2024 · Anatomy of an API Response in JSON Format . But the json response I am receiving is having the date as below format: {Createddate: /date (345667999)/} But when I hit preview data its giving the correct date format. Root Element. JSON, known for its simplicity and versatility, suits a broad range of applications, offering lightweight, human-readable data exchange. datetime: A string value conforming to the ISO 8601 format. This format is highly recommended due to its unambiguous representation and widespread support in programming languages and frameworks. Jan 1, 2012 · Recommended date format for REST GET API. For example, the data type for DateValidated is string (date). XML (eXtensible Markup Language) XML is more structured format where data is enclosed within opening and closing tags. We can use the @JsonFormat annotation to format a specific field: JSON Data Type Description; string: Any sequence of characters added between double quotes. Aug 23, 2022 · RFC 3339, titled "Date and Time on the Internet: Timestamps”, defines a subset of ISO8601 in section 5. Date format, which by default uses the format Jan 6, 2025 · JSON APIs: Introduction, Usage, and Examples. Nov 8, 2023 · REST API and JSON Overview. The good thing is that JSON is a human-readable as well as a machine-readable format. There are also JSON API description formats: Swagger. (yyyy-mm-dd). 3. OData JSON Protocol - Very complicated. Jul 27, 2023 · Most modern programming languages, including Node. For system dates, the developer experience should be optimized for precision and correctness. HAL - Like OData but aiming to be HATEOAS like. vbihf wyybo vlmnzx zbjjlwx wgni zhqhh vlsmite hckiym mxqbsdv hlhbycs pbqdn kzynvjb ymxeasykg hcmzsk cqwwuet